  • Hash function for the DB_HASH access method

    Hello!
    I use BDB 4.5.20 and tried to use a DB_HASH access method providing my own hash function, since I have very specific keys. Keys are UUID, and they all have the same length (16 bytes) and specific binary representation which can be used to generate hash code. After I set own hash function using Db::set_h_hash() I get the call of this function during database open with a very strange data I was not expected.
    Backtrace is:
    storaged.dll!tbricks::storage::StorageBDBBackend::bdb_hash_func(Db * db=0x01dba398, const void * key=0x1318326c, unsigned int size=12) Line 35     C++
    libdb45d.dll!_db_h_hash_intercept_c(__db * cthis=0x01dba418, const void * data=0x1318326c, unsigned int len=12) Line 483 + 0x97 bytes     C++
    libdb45d.dll!__ham_init_meta(__db * dbp=0x01dba418, hashmeta33 * meta=0x01dbb120, unsigned int pgno=0, _db_lsn * lsnp=0x0013f10c) Line 291 + 0x13 bytes     C
    libdb45d.dll!__ham_new_file(__db * dbp=0x01dba418, __db_txn * txn=0x01dbacc8, __fh_t * fhp=0x01dbafb8, const char * name=0x01dbac60) Line 402 + 0x13 bytes     C
    libdb45d.dll!__db_new_file(__db * dbp=0x01dba418, __db_txn * txn=0x01dbacc8, __fh_t * fhp=0x01dbafb8, const char * name=0x01dbac60) Line 284 + 0x15 bytes     C
    libdb45d.dll!__fop_file_setup(__db * dbp=0x01dba418, __db_txn * txn=0x01dba9e0, const char * name=0x01585624, int mode=384, unsigned int flags=129, unsigned int * retidp=0x0013f458) Line 586 + 0x42 bytes     C
    libdb45d.dll!__db_open(__db * dbp=0x01dba418, __db_txn * txn=0x01dba9e0, const char * fname=0x01585624, const char * dname=0x00000000, DBTYPE type=DB_HASH, unsigned int flags=129, int mode=0, unsigned int meta_pgno=0) Line 154 + 0x1d bytes     C
    libdb45d.dll!__db_open_pp(__db * dbp=0x01dba418, __db_txn * txn=0x01dba9e0, const char * fname=0x01585624, const char * dname=0x00000000, DBTYPE type=DB_HASH, unsigned int flags=129, int mode=0) Line 1079 + 0x23 bytes     C
    libdb45d.dll!Db::open(DbTxn * txnid=0x00000000, const char * file=0x01585624, const char * database=0x00000000, DBTYPE type=DB_HASH, unsigned int flags=33554561, int mode=0) Line 313 + 0x30 bytes     C++
    storaged.dll!tbricks::storage::BDBBackend::open_db(Db & db={...}, const char * fileName=0x01585624, DBTYPE dbType=DB_HASH) Line 372 + 0x21 bytes     C++
    Db::set_h_hash() documentation says nothing about behaviour like this.
    Why BDB calls my hash function during database open while I do not put()/get() any data?
    Firstly I was implemented hash function aborting the application if key length is not equal 16, because it looks like application internal error, and for sure application was aborted because of that.
    How should I treat this data and do I have to return any hash code at all in this case?

    A quick look at the code indicates that this call is to run the hash function against a known value ("%$sniglet^&") to store the result in the DB file (or to compare the result against a result stored in the file, if the file already exists). Since a failure of this comparison prints "hash: incompatible hash function", I think we can assume that this is done to ensure the hash function being used is compatible with the hash function used when the DB file was created.
    So you need to be able to provide some form of hash output for this.

  • Access method and wait event

    hi,
    i am confused about access method and wait event.
    is there any relation between access method and wait event?

    sb92075 wrote:
    is there any relation between access method and wait event?No relationI disagree. If access method is full table scan or fast full index scan, that's likely to cause db file scattered read waits, whereas an index driven access method such as index range scan will likely cause db file sequential read waits.

  • CVS: access method is not installed

    Hello,
    i don't get the CVS connection working.
    I have installed WinCVS, in the "About Box" of JDeveloper i can read "(CVSNT) 2.0.41a (client/server). CVS from the command line works fine, also WinCVS is happy.
    Then i create a CVS connection JDeveloper, and regardless which access method i choose (pserver,ntserver, ...) i get:
    Testing connection...
    the :ntserver: access method is not installed on this system
    Connection test failed: unable to connect.
    when i press "test connection".
    What to do ?
    Regards
    René

    WinCVS probably comes bundled with an older version of cvsnt that still supports the ntserver protocol. I think the CVS executable used by WinCVS is in the WinCVS installation directory. If you're getting errors in JDev that you're not getting from that specific cvs.exe, yor PATH probably doesn't have the correct directory first, and hence JDev is picking up a different version of CVS. Try putting the WinCVS directory first thing in your PATH.
